Diltigesic: Definition, Composition, and Pharmacological Class

Diltigesic is the trade name for a medicinal preparation whose active component is the international non-proprietary name (INN) compound, Diltiazem hydrochloride, which is exclusively available by prescription. This active agent is a synthetic organic compound that is chemically identified as a benzothiazepine derivative. Diltiazem belongs to the definitive pharmacological class of calcium channel blockers (CCBs), also referred to as slow channel blockers. This active agent modulates cardiovascular function across its various indications.


How is Diltiazem Classified and What is Its General Purpose?

Diltiazem is specifically categorized as a non-dihydropyridine type of calcium channel blocker, which provides it with a notable dual action profile. This classification distinguishes the compound because it not only promotes the relaxation and widening of blood vessels (vasodilation) but also exerts a significant influence on the electrical signals within the heart, notably at the atrioventricular (AV) node. The primary objective of Diltiazem therapy is to stabilize the heart's function; this action effectively reduces the overall workload placed upon the cardiovascular system and helps normalize certain rapid or irregular heart rhythms. Diltiazem's unique pharmacological profile allows for simultaneous control over both heart rate and vascular tone. Consequently, Diltiazem is intended to help the heart work more efficiently and regularly.


Available Forms and Delivery Type

The active ingredient, Diltiazem hydrochloride, is manufactured for systemic administration and is available in multiple pharmaceutical forms intended for different durations of effect. These forms commonly include tablets and extended-release capsules for oral ingestion, which are suitable for long-term chronic management. Additionally, a sterile intravenous solution is prepared for parenteral (injection) administration, which is reserved for controlled interventions requiring immediate action in a clinical setting. Diltigesic, as a specific brand, is typically associated with the oral forms of Diltiazem, such as capsules or tablets.

What side effects are possible with Diltigesic?

The official safety profile for Diltigesic (Diltiazem hydrochloride) is established through regulatory classification, grouping potential effects by frequency and the physiological system involved.

Frequency and System-Organ-Class Safety Profile

Adverse reactions are classified based on their incidence in clinical data:

  • Common Reactions (affecting 1% to 10% of users) typically include headache, dizziness, fatigue, flushing, and peripheral edema (swelling), which is often associated with long-term use. Effects on the heart, such as bradycardia (slowed heart rate) and first-degree Atrioventricular (AV) block, are also commonly listed.
  • Uncommon Reactions (affecting 0.1% to 1% of users) may involve nausea, nervousness, insomnia, or changes in blood pressure, such as hypotension.

Adverse effects are officially grouped by the affected body system, including Cardiac, Vascular, Nervous System, and Gastrointestinal disorders, reflecting the systemic nature of the medicine's action.


Serious Adverse Reactions and Safety Restrictions

Regulatory documents list certain rare but serious adverse reactions, which include the development of high-degree AV block (second- or third-degree), congestive heart failure, acute hepatic injury, and Severe Cutaneous Adverse Reactions (SCAR).

The safety profile includes clear restrictions known as contraindications. Diltigesic should not be used in individuals with pre-existing conditions such as Sick Sinus Syndrome (unless a pacemaker is present), existing high-degree AV block (unless a pacemaker is present), or severe hypotension (low blood pressure).

Population-Specific Notes: The safety profile notes that caution is required in patients with hepatic impairment (liver dysfunction) due to reduced drug clearance. Furthermore, some cardiac events may be more likely to occur upon treatment initiation or during dose changes in vulnerable patients.

Overdose and Emergency Response

Overdose and when to seek help

Overdose of Diltiazem is defined by regulatory authorities as a severe exacerbation of its effects on the cardiovascular system. Documented clinical manifestations primarily involve profound cardiodepression and systemic hemodynamic collapse.

Documented Manifestations:

  • Severe hypotension (abnormally low blood pressure).
  • Marked bradycardia (abnormally slow heart rate).
  • High-degree atrioventricular (AV) block, which indicates severe impairment of electrical conduction.

Required Emergency Actions:

  • Immediate medical attention must be sought for any known or suspected overdose, as explicitly stated in regulatory guidance.
  • Overdose may progress to life-threatening outcomes such as cardiac failure, irreversible impaired cardiac conduction, or refractory shock, necessitating urgent care.

Management as Described in Official Labels: The regulatory documents confirm that no specific antidote is known for Diltiazem overdose. Therefore, clinical management must be symptomatic and supportive, based on the severity of the patient's condition.

Required supportive measures may include the administration of specific agents like Atropine for bradycardia, vasopressors for severe hypotension, and inotropic agents for cardiac failure. Continuous cardiac monitoring and hospitalization for observation and treatment are mandated requirements due to the risk of delayed or escalating complications.

Eligibility and Restrictions for Use

Eligibility Rules for Diltigesic Use

Diltigesic (Diltiazem hydrochloride) use is restricted to the adult population for its approved indications, with strict eligibility rules defined by regulatory authorities.

Use is absolutely prohibited (contraindicated) for several patient populations. These include individuals with severe hypotension (systolic pressure less than 90 mmHg), and those with sick sinus syndrome or second- or third-degree AV block unless a functioning ventricular pacemaker is present. The medicine is also contraindicated for patients with recent acute myocardial infarction complicated by pulmonary congestion, and those with certain severe irregular heart rhythms such as atrial fibrillation/flutter associated with an accessory bypass tract (e.g., Wolff-Parkinson-White syndrome).

Eligibility is restricted or conditional for other groups. The medicine is generally not recommended for the pediatric population, as safety and effectiveness have not been established in children. Use requires caution in older adults and in patients with impaired hepatic (liver) or renal (kidney) function, as higher drug concentrations may occur in these populations. Additionally, Diltiazem is typically not recommended for women who are pregnant or breastfeeding due to official regulatory status regarding potential risk and excretion into milk.

What should I know about interactions with other medicines?

Interactions with other medicines and products

Diltigesic (Diltiazem) exhibits documented interaction patterns primarily involving metabolic interference and additive effects on cardiac function, as outlined in official government regulatory information.

Contraindicated Combinations

Certain combinations are formally prohibited in regulatory labeling due to the high risk of severe adverse outcomes. These include co-administration with Ivabradine, due to the potential for profound bradycardia, and Pimozide, which carries a risk of increased ventricular arrhythmias. Additionally, agents like Flibanserin and Lomitapide are contraindicated as Diltiazem's metabolic effects significantly increase their plasma concentrations.

Pharmacokinetic and Pharmacodynamic Interactions

Diltiazem is documented as a moderate inhibitor of the CYP3A4 enzyme and the transporter P-glycoprotein (P-gp). This inhibition results in increased exposure and higher plasma concentrations of numerous co-administered drugs that are substrates for these systems, including certain statins (e.g., Simvastatin) and immunosuppressants (e.g., Cyclosporine). Co-administration with CYP3A4 inducers such as Rifampin or the herbal product St. John's Wort may reduce Diltiazem's efficacy. Furthermore, official labeling notes pharmacodynamic interactions with cardiac depressants like Beta-Blockers and Digoxin, increasing the risk of additive effects on the heart's conduction system, specifically bradycardia and AV block. The extended-release formulation requires avoidance of alcohol due to the risk of rapid drug release.

Mechanism of Action

Targeted Calcium Channel Blockade

Diltiazem, the active ingredient, functions by selectively blocking L-type Voltage-Gated Calcium Channels ( L-VGCCs), primarily on vascular and smooth muscle cells. This action directly prevents the influx of extracellular calcium ions ( Ca^2+) required to trigger muscle contraction, defining the initial molecular step of the mechanism.

Modulation of Excitation-Contraction Coupling

By limiting the intracellular concentration of Ca^2+, Diltigesic disrupts the excitation-contraction coupling pathway. This molecular interference reduces the activation of contractile proteins, leading to the relaxation of smooth muscle tissues and the resulting vasodilation (widening of blood vessels), which defines a major physiological consequence of the drug's mechanism.

Influence on Cardiac Electrical Conduction

Beyond muscle relaxation, the drug also engages mechanisms that influence heart rhythm by blocking L-VGCCs within the atrioventricular ( AV) node. This specifically slows the transmission of electrical signals, delaying conduction time.

Dosage and Administration Information

How to Use Diltigesic: Administration Guidelines

Administration of Diltiazem (the active ingredient in Diltigesic) involves specific instructions addressing both long-term and acute clinical needs. Standardized protocols define the forms, routes, and dosing parameters.


Routes and Forms

Administration Scope Administration Details
Route of Administration The medicine is for Oral use, encompassing immediate-release tablets and extended-release capsules, and Intravenous (IV) use for acute, monitored settings.
Standard Dosing Schedule Oral Extended-Release forms are typically initiated at 120 mg to 240 mg once daily for adults, with maximum doses up to 540 mg once daily. Immediate-Release forms are usually prescribed in divided doses, such as four times daily.
IV Administration Used for immediate rate control, this route involves a weight-based bolus dose (e.g., 0.25 mg/kg) followed by a continuous infusion, typically maintained at initial rates of 5 mg to 10 mg per hour.

Key Administration Conditions and Restrictions

Specific parameters apply to the use of this medication:

  • Intake Conditions: Some extended-release capsules and tablets may be taken without regard to food. For some forms, the contents may be sprinkled on soft foods like applesauce and swallowed without chewing.
  • Handling Restriction: Extended-release tablets and capsules must not be crushed or chewed to preserve the controlled-release mechanism of the formulation.
  • Titration and Duration: Dosage adjustments for chronic oral therapy are typically performed over intervals of 7 to 14 days. IV administration is generally limited to a 24-hour continuous infusion.
  • Special Populations: Standardized protocols include utilizing lower starting doses and cautious monitoring in older adults and patients with hepatic or renal impairment. Safety and efficacy have not been established for use in the pediatric population.

Frequently Asked Questions (FAQ)

Common questions about Diltigesic (FAQ)


Q: How quickly does Diltigesic typically start to reduce discomfort or other symptoms?

Official studies examining the use of topical diltiazem for anal fissures have reported reductions in pain and irritation scores starting as early as 1 week after treatment begins. This indicates that the drug’s relaxing effect on the local smooth muscle usually starts contributing to symptom improvement within this initial period. Full healing, however, may take longer.


Q: Does Diltigesic interact with common over-the-counter pain relievers or cold medications?

Official documents describe Diltiazem as a CYP3A4 inhibitor, a classification indicating it can potentially increase the levels of other medications in the body. While common over-the-counter (OTC) pain relievers are not individually listed, patients are advised to consult with a healthcare professional or pharmacist about any specific OTC medications used to understand the potential for interaction.


Q: Are there any known interactions between Diltigesic and herbal supplements or vitamins?

The official prescribing information notes that certain herbal products can interact with Diltiazem. Specifically, co-administration with St. John’s Wort is warned against because it may reduce the drug’s effectiveness. Patients are advised to discuss all supplements or herbal remedies with their prescribing physician or pharmacist before use.


Q: Does Diltigesic address the underlying cause of the condition or only provide symptomatic relief?

Topical diltiazem functions by relaxing smooth muscles at the site of application, which helps reduce pressure and spasms. This mechanism is thought to promote the healing of the tear by increasing local blood flow while also providing relief from associated symptoms like pain.


Q: What does current clinical research say about the overall success rate of Diltigesic?

Studies have examined the outcomes of topical diltiazem use for chronic anal fissures. Evidence indicates that the drug can offer significant healing rates, with some research reporting effectiveness as high as 70–75%.


Q: Is Diltigesic associated with any changes in mood or sleep patterns?

Regulatory documents classify insomnia (difficulty sleeping) and nervousness as uncommon side effects of Diltiazem. Other central nervous system effects such as abnormal dreams and depression have also been reported in official safety profiles.


Q: Does Diltigesic affect other muscles in the body?

Diltiazem is a calcium channel blocker whose primary action is on smooth muscle cells (found in blood vessels and certain organs) and the electrical conduction of the heart. Official pharmacological information does not indicate a significant effect on skeletal muscles (those involved in voluntary movement).


Q: Is Diltigesic the same drug as diltiazem, and are the uses different?

Diltiazem hydrochloride is the active pharmaceutical ingredient. Diltigesic is a specific brand name product containing diltiazem, often used to refer to the topical gel formulation. The uses differ depending on the form: oral tablets are for systemic heart conditions, while the topical gel is for local treatment of conditions like anal fissures.


Q: What specific conditions are officially approved for treatment with Diltigesic topical applications?

The topical formulation of Diltigesic Organogel is prescribed for the localized treatment of anal fissures. This is the primary condition addressed by this specific dosage form.


Q: Why is Diltigesic sometimes prescribed as a topical gel and other times as an oral tablet?

The different forms are used to achieve different therapeutic goals. The oral tablet is intended for systemic conditions affecting the whole body, such as high blood pressure. The topical gel allows the medication to act locally on the smooth muscle at the application site for conditions like anal fissures.


Q: How does the topical formulation of Diltigesic work to help with its primary condition?

The medication works by relaxing the anal sphincter muscle, which is often tightly constricted in the condition it treats. This action reduces local pressure and helps to increase blood flow to the affected tissue, thereby assisting in the natural healing process.


Q: What are the most commonly reported local side effects of Diltigesic cream or gel?

According to the official product information for the topical form, common side effects are often localized to the application area. These are described as application site reactions and may include temporary feelings of burning, irritation, itching, or redness.


Q: Are there any signs of systemic absorption or side effects when using Diltigesic topically?

While the topical formulation is designed for local action, minor absorption into the bloodstream is possible. Official information notes that systemic effects are uncommon, but some patients may experience side effects such as headache or dizziness due to this absorption.


Q: What should a patient know about application site reactions like burning, itching, or redness?

Localized application site reactions like burning or itching are described as common when using the gel. It is advised in patient materials that these symptoms are usually mild, but it is recommended that a healthcare provider be informed if the irritation persists or worsens during the treatment period.


Q: What is the generally expected duration of treatment with Diltigesic cream?

The expected duration of treatment for the condition Diltigesic treats is generally determined by the treating physician. Based on established guidelines, the course of treatment often lasts for a set duration, frequently a maximum of 6 to 8 weeks.


Q: What are the general guidelines for a patient who misses an application of Diltigesic?

Official guidelines state that if a patient misses an application, official guidance indicates the dose may be applied as soon as it is remembered. However, if it is nearly time for the next scheduled dose, the official guidance is to skip the missed dose and continue with the regular schedule.


Q: Can using Diltigesic affect a person's blood pressure even when applied topically?

Because minor absorption can occur, there is a possibility that Diltigesic could influence blood pressure even when applied topically. Low blood pressure (hypotension) is listed as a possible side effect, although official sources indicate this is uncommon with the topical formulation.


Q: Is it necessary to use a finger cot or glove when applying Diltigesic cream?

For hygienic and safety reasons, official product information often notes the use of a finger covering when applying the topical gel. This covering can be a disposable glove or a finger cot to ensure a clean application process.


Q: Is it normal to experience increased pain or irritation immediately after applying Diltigesic for the first time?

While the first application may be uneventful for many patients, it is possible for some individuals to develop temporary application site reactions. These reactions, such as perianal itching or irritation, may occur during the initial phase of treatment.


Q: What should a person do if they accidentally swallow a small amount of the topical Diltigesic gel?

If a person has accidentally swallowed a small amount of the topical gel, official regulatory guidance indicates that immediate contact with a healthcare professional is necessary. It is also recommended to seek advice from a poison control center or hospital in this situation.


Q: Are there different potencies or strengths of Diltigesic topical gel available?

Based on clinical studies and commercial availability, the most common strength of diltiazem topical gel used for the treatment of anal fissures is 2% diltiazem hydrochloride. Any other strength would require specific compounding and prescribing instructions.


Q: What is the significance of 'Organogel' in the brand name Diltigesic Organogel?

The term 'Organogel' refers to the delivery vehicle or base of the gel formulation. This base is specifically formulated to enhance the medication's stability and improve its transport and retention at the application site.


Q: Do official patient information leaflets mention anything about the drug's shelf life after opening?

While specific instructions vary by product, compounding guidelines suggest that topical preparations in tubes are typically valid for up to 3 months after being opened. Regardless of this general guidance, patients are advised to strictly follow the expiry date and specific instructions provided on their individual packaging.


Q: Is it common to see the empty shell of a tablet in stool when taking oral diltiazem formulations?

Yes, if you are taking the extended-release oral formulations of Diltiazem, it is common to occasionally see what is often called a 'ghost pill' in the stool. This is the empty matrix or shell of the tablet, which means the active medicine has generally been released and absorbed by the body.


Q: Is Diltigesic used to prevent the return of the condition?

Official information does not describe Diltigesic as a definitive preventative measure. Studies have noted that recurrences of the condition can occur, but it has been noted that these are often responsive to repeat treatment with the topical medication.


Q: Are there any known genetic factors that affect how Diltigesic is processed?

Studies indicate that certain genetic variations can influence how the body processes Diltiazem. Specifically, variations in the CYP3A4 and CYP3A5 enzymes are known to affect the concentration of the drug in the bloodstream.

How should Diltigesic be stored and disposed of?

How to Store and Dispose of Diltigesic?

Storing Diltigesic (diltiazem) requires adherence to specific conditions detailed in regulatory labeling to maintain product stability and protect against accidental ingestion.


Storage Requirements

Condition Requirement
Temperature Store at Controlled Room Temperature, typically 20 C to 25 C (68 F to 77 F).
Protection Keep in a tightly closed, light-resistant container away from excessive heat and moisture.
Child Safety Keep out of the sight and reach of children using a child-resistant closure and storing the product in a secure, elevated location.

Disposal Instructions

Unused or expired Diltigesic should be disposed of via an official drug take-back program. If no program is available, mix the medicine with an undesirable substance (e.g., used coffee grounds) and seal it in a container before discarding it in the household trash. The medication must not be flushed down the toilet or placed in wastewater unless explicitly instructed by official labeling.
